Alex 'Barney' McLure (1916-2005) was an Australian rugby league footballer who played in the 1940s.
Playing career
McLure featured only in the 1942 NSWRFL season for the St George club. McLure was a noted Sydney domestic rugby union player that played for Gordon RFC that switched to Rugby League during the war years. [2]
Death
McLure died on 15 March 2005 at Kingsgrove, New South Wales, age 88. [3]
